Adam and Eve and Dino

Jimmy Fowler
Fort Worth can look forward to what Dallas already has: A highway billboard ad for a Kentucky “creation science” museum that implies dinosaurs hung out with Adam and Eve in the Garden of Eden. The Creation Museum has launch...